How to check ETH ETF daily performance? (Price tracking)
Official ETH ETF sites, data aggregators, broker tools, on-chain metrics, and SEC filings collectively provide real-time pricing, NAV, holdings, and arbitrage signals—enabling precise tracking and trading of Ethereum spot ETFs.

Accessing Official ETF Provider Websites
1. Each approved Ethereum spot ETF issuer maintains a dedicated product page with real-time and historical pricing data. BlackRock’s iShares Ethereum Trust (ETHA) displays intraday net asset value (NAV), market price, and premium/discount metrics directly on its fund detail page.
2. Grayscale’s Ethereum Trust (ETHE) publishes daily NAV updates after 6:00 PM ET, alongside closing market price and volume figures in its official fact sheet.
3. Fidelity’s FBET provides a live ticker widget embedded on its fund landing page, showing last traded price, change percentage, and 52-week high/low—updated every 15 seconds during market hours.
4. VanEck’s ETHV site features a downloadable daily performance PDF that includes opening price, high, low, close, and total return since inception.
Using Financial Data Aggregators
1. Yahoo Finance lists all major ETH ETF tickers with interactive charts, volume heatmaps, and comparative performance against ETHUSD spot price over customizable timeframes.
2. Bloomberg Terminal users can pull ETFETH Index to access institutional-grade analytics including bid-ask spread depth, creation/redemption activity, and authorized participant flows.
3. CoinGecko’s “ETF Tracker” tab aggregates real-time market prices, 24-hour volume, and net inflows/outflows across all SEC-approved Ethereum ETFs in a single sortable table.
4. TradingView allows users to overlay multiple ETH ETF tickers on one chart, apply technical indicators like Bollinger Bands or RSI, and set price alerts for specific thresholds.
Leveraging Brokerage Platform Tools
1. Interactive Brokers displays ETF-level Level 2 order book data, including top 10 bid/ask levels and size, enabling precise execution analysis for large orders.
2. Fidelity Investments’ Active Trader Pro offers a “Fund Screener” where users filter by asset class, expense ratio, and daily price change—then export results to CSV.
3. E*TRADE’s Market Dashboard includes a “Crypto ETF Watchlist” with auto-refreshing columns for last price, % change, and net asset value deviation.
4. Schwab’s ETF Lookup tool returns daily performance metrics alongside holdings breakdown, showing exact ETH exposure percentage and custody provider details.
Monitoring On-Chain and Derivative Signals
1. The ETH ETF Premium/Discount Index, published daily by CryptoQuant, calculates weighted average deviation between market price and NAV across all spot ETFs—values above +0.5% signal potential arbitrage opportunities.
2. Glassnode tracks ETH inflows into ETF custodial wallets, publishing daily net deposit volumes in ETH and USD equivalents, correlated with ETF share creation activity.
3. Skew.com provides implied volatility surfaces for ETH options, allowing traders to infer market expectations about near-term ETF-driven demand shifts.
4. Token Terminal reports daily ETF AUM changes, derived from NAV multiplied by outstanding shares, highlighting capital rotation trends between spot and futures-based products.
Reading Regulatory Filings and Daily Reports
1. SEC Form N-PORT filings, submitted monthly by ETF sponsors, disclose end-of-period holdings—including exact ETH balance, custody address, and valuation methodology—but daily NAV is not included.
2. Daily NAV statements are filed as exhibits to Form 8-K; these documents appear in the SEC’s EDGAR database within hours of market close and contain audited per-share values.
3. Some issuers publish daily “Creation Unit Activity” summaries indicating how many shares were issued or redeemed, offering insight into institutional demand pressure.
4. The Depository Trust & Clearing Corporation (DTCC) releases daily ETF share count changes, visible through its public transparency portal, reflecting net issuance at the DTC level.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Do ETH ETFs track ETH price exactly?ETH ETFs aim to reflect the spot price of Ethereum but may deviate due to management fees, custody costs, market liquidity constraints, and NAV calculation timing differences.
Q: Why does ETHE often trade at a discount while ETHA trades near NAV?ETHE lacks daily redemption mechanisms and carries higher fees, leading to structural discounts. ETHA operates under Rule 19b-4 with continuous creation/redemption, tightening its price-to-NAV alignment.
Q: Can I see real-time ETH holdings inside an ETF?Real-time ETH balances are not publicly available. Verified wallet addresses are disclosed in quarterly filings, and on-chain analytics firms estimate balances using transaction clustering heuristics.
Q: Are ETF price movements always synchronized with ETHUSD swings?No. During US market hours, ETFs react strongly to ETH price action. Outside those hours, they respond to futures markets, geopolitical news, and macro sentiment—sometimes diverging significantly from spot ETH moves.
